Chapter 209 First Round Upset



The individual battles officially began on the second day, and as usual, they were divided into three groups: Qi Refining, Foundation Establishment, and Golden Core.

Unlike the previous four categories of pills, talismans, weapons, and formations, the battleground has always been a fiercely contested area among the three sects: the Lianfeng Sword Sect, which is dominated by sword cultivators; the Yuxing Sect, which focuses on beast taming; and the Fuyuan Sect, which is a sect of magic cultivators.

This is the usual practice. Because each of the previous categories has its own sect specializing in them, but there are no separate competitions for swordsmanship, magic, or beast taming.

But this year the situation has changed drastically. The Lianfeng Sword Sect has produced an all-around genius! Shi Xuan single-handedly defeated all the other sects!

The sect leaders of Fuyuan Sect and Yuxing Sect privately complained to Shi Mingxiu, saying, "Your Lianfeng Sword Sect has already exceeded its target in this competition. You don't need to win any more individual matches."

Shi Mingxiu was quite agreeable, stroking his long beard and replying with a smile, "I really can't say for sure. Why don't you go talk to the disciples from our sect who participated in the competition? Tell them not to take first place again."

...

Sending the sect leader to do such a thing? How could he even think of that? If the two of them actually went, they'd be laughed at to death.

The two men rolled their eyes at him and turned to leave.

In fact, the morale of the Lianfeng Sword Sect, whose members have become rich overnight, is soaring. The disciples are like they've been injected with chicken blood, and they are even more courageous than before. In addition, their sword cultivators are the strongest among their peers, and the Lianfeng Sword Sect has won first place in both the Qi Refining and Foundation Establishment groups.

The Yuxing Sect and Fuyuan Sect, having gained nothing, felt utterly exhausted. While other sects at least had one or two who won the championship, they had all been runners-up.

However, after thinking about the other three sects that had lost first place in their specialized fields, he felt a little better. After all, they had experienced similar situations before, but the collective annihilation of the other three sects was something he had never seen before.

Each group of contests takes at least three days, and by the time they reached the Golden Core group, it was already the seventh day.

When they saw Shi Xuan stand on the competition stage again, the disciples of the six sects were numb. Anyway, she'd participate in any competition she could... and she'd win every competition she participated in... and the disciples of the Lianfeng Sword Sect would bet on any competition in which she won...

However, this singles tournament is different from other events, as it features top players from various disciplines and offers the highest rewards.

To win first place here is much more competitive and difficult than in previous competitions.

The first match was between Mi Sui of the Yuxing Sect and Fan Mingzhu of the Shending Sect.

The outcome of this matchup was truly a foregone conclusion. Mi Sui was one of the most talented disciples of the Yuxing Sect, and he had won the top spot in the Foundation Establishment group during the last Six Sects Grand Competition.

Among the early bets this year, Mi Sui is also a favorite to win the Golden Elixir Group championship.

As for Fan Mingzhu, she was just a pill cultivator from the Divine Cauldron Sect. How could she possibly defeat Mi Sui, a genius disciple of the Yuxing Sect?

Everyone thought the same thing; they weren't even paying close attention to what was happening on stage. They were sure that Mi Sui would knock Fan Mingzhu off the stage in no time.

Mi Sui's spirit pet was an enormous silver wolf, so tall that it could stand as tall as two people and looked extremely fierce. Just by standing on the platform, it seemed capable of frightening timid cultivators into surrendering.

On the stage right now, the petite Fan Mingzhu is facing a huge, ferocious wolf. The contrast is stark, and it's clear who is stronger and who is weaker.

Despite the obvious disparity in strength, Mi Sui and his silver wolf fought Fan Mingzhu for half an hour without a clear victor.

"Fan Mingzhu is quite capable."

"So, she switched from alchemy to magic cultivation? Her alchemy skills seem to have completely deteriorated, but her martial arts have improved significantly."

"The daughter of the Divine Cauldron Sect Master can actually abandon alchemy and cultivate martial arts. I admire her greatly."

"You can only admire one of Fan Mingzhu and Shi Xuan. Don't forget the deep-seated hatred between them."

"But... sigh, who can say for sure about these things..."

...

The battle on the stage was still fierce. Fan Mingzhu was agile and mainly dodged in the early stages. She seemed to be particularly sharp and always managed to avoid Mi Sui's attacks.

The battle lasted for nearly an hour when Mi Sui's silver wolf suddenly froze for a moment, then its reaction became slower and slower. Before long, it even became unsteady on its feet, until it finally collapsed to the ground with a thud.

The judges and sect leaders on the main stage were all puzzled by this scene. They couldn't see anything wrong. They didn't see what method Fan Mingzhu used to make Mi Sui's silver wolf fall to the ground, or perhaps Mi Sui's silver wolf had a problem on its own? Fan Mingzhu's luck was too good.

Even at the end, Mi Sui didn't understand what had happened, why the perfectly healthy Silver Wolf had suddenly collapsed. But he knew it definitely wasn't Silver Wolf that had a problem with itself; Fan Mingzhu must have done something to it.

This silver wolf had been with him for many years, and the two were of one mind. He had never felt any physical discomfort from the silver wolf. It was only later, when the silver wolf began to show unusual behavior, that he noticed it.

In any case, the fall of the silver wolf signifies the end of the battle. The Yuxing Sect relies on spirit pets as its primary means of combat. If they couldn't defeat their opponents when their spirit pets were present, then it's even less likely they can now do so without them.

Fan Mingzhu wins this round!

The audience erupted in uproar. No one had expected that the seeded player in this one-on-one battle would be eliminated by a mere alchemist!

"This is impossible! How could Mi Sui have been defeated by Fan Mingzhu?"

"Ah, I bet on Mi Sui to win the singles championship! How could he not even make it past the first round!"

"Am I in a hallucination? This result seems too much like a hallucination. Someone please wake me up!"

...

Even after the results of the battle were announced, they still couldn't believe what they were seeing.

The disciples of Yuxing Sect were also dumbfounded. They knew Mi Sui's strength best. Even the elders in the sect often said that Mi Sui was a rare talent that was hard to come by in decades. It would be one thing if he had lost to a powerful opponent, but he had lost to a pill cultivator.

Who is Fan Mingzhu? How come they've never heard of her before and she seems to have any influence?!

But the matter is already settled.

Fan Mingzhu smiled slightly and walked off the stage in a good mood. After so many days, she finally felt relieved.

After defeating one of the seeded players, and seeing the astonished looks on the faces of those idiots in the audience, she felt refreshed and invigorated.

Before stepping off the stage, she glanced in Shi Xuan's direction, thinking to herself that Shi Xuan had better be eliminated early in this competition. If she met her on the stage, she would definitely make her pay!

Shi Xuan noticed that Fan Mingzhu was looking at her, but she didn't even glance at her, completely ignoring Fan Mingzhu.

When Shi Xuan took the stage, her opponent was not strong and she easily won.

However, compared to Fan Mingzhu's victory over Mi Sui, Shi Xuan's victory did not cause any stir.

That's perfectly normal. Anyone could easily defeat an opponent like that. What's so special about Shi Xuan winning against him?
